Pope Francis names Syro-Malabar cardinal to head Interreligious Dialogue dicastery

  • Cardinal Koovakad expressed gratitude for his appointment and emphasized the importance of interreligious dialogue for peace among peoples.
  • The Dicastery for Interreligious Dialogue was established during the Second Vatican Council to promote relations with other religions, including Islam.
  • Cardinal Koovakad has coordinated several of Pope Francis' trips focused on religious dialogue, including visits to Kazakhstan, Bahrain, and Mongolia.
